Parts of Saskatchewan and Manitoba have truly been coping with a major wintry wallop this week, as a robust Texas decreased stalls over southerly Manitoba.

Eastern Saskatchewan and western Manitoba birthed the burden of the snow on Tuesday, with the heaviest build-ups dropping alongside the agricultural boundary. For a couple of of the harder-hit places, so long as 40 centimeters was anticipated by the point all is claimed and performed. Winds likewise began to seize all through the day Tuesday, together with unsafe blowing snow to the guidelines of threats car drivers encountered.

The snow has truly contemplating that decreased in Saskatchewan, with merely a lot of centimetres left close to the Manitoba boundary withWednesday After hefty moisten Tuesday, Winnipeg, Man., noticed the shift over to snow, which will definitely proceed with the preliminary part ofWednesday Western areas of Manitoba may nonetheless seize 5-10 centimeters, with north places eligible an extra 20 centimeters, additionally. That triggered quite a few establishment and bus terminations all through the district preliminary level Wednesday.

Blowing snow will definitely likewise proceed to be a priority all through Wednesday, with gusting wind gusts of roughly 70 km/h dangerous whiteout issues.

“Consider postponing non-essential travel until conditions improve,” claimed Environment and Climate Change Canada (ECCC) within the wintertime twister advising launched very earlyWednesday “Prepare for quickly changing and deteriorating travel conditions.”

The snow will definitely reduce and winds will progressively cut back sooner or later Wednesday.

First vital wintertime twister ruins touring

On Tuesday, the Saskatchewan Royal Canadian Mounted Police (RCMP) replied to 44 car accidents due to the assault of freezing issues.

“The most common of these incidents were vehicles in the ditch and jackknifed semis,” the RCMP claimed in a news release.

Highway closures, consisting of areas of Highway 1, had been reported in Saskatchewan and Manitoba very early Wednesday early morning.

Another prevalent and substantial snowfall may strike lots of the southerly and essential Prairies as soon as once more this weekend break. It is prematurely to consider in snow whole quantities and the place the heaviest snow will definitely drop, nevertheless this may need an extra vital affect on touring all through the Prairies.
